Wasserwirtschaftsamt: New display board on the Saale river

The Hof Water Management Office has renewed its information board on the Saale and redesigned the content.

The aim is to raise visitors' awareness of the development of the Saale in the urban environment and the risk of flooding.

Comparison with 1905

 

A comparison of the situation on the Saale in Hof around 1905 and today can be seen. The function of the Saale and the uses of the floodplain have changed significantly over this period. In the past, water power was used mainly by mills and the floodplain was used for bleaching and washing. At the same time, the Saale and its mill canals were used for wastewater disposal. With increasing industrialization, the quality of the Saale deteriorated more and more and it became a stinking cesspool. The construction of the wastewater collector at the Hof sewage treatment plant, the addition of water from the Förmitz reservoir and initial renaturation measures in the 1990s significantly improved the water quality again, making the Saale floodplains popular for recreational use. However, in order to achieve a good condition as a habitat for animals and plants, further work needs to be done on structure and quality.

Flood protection

 

Since industrialization, more and more buildings have been constructed in the Saale floodplains. The risk of flooding for buildings and infrastructure has been significantly reduced by the construction of flood protection dykes and walls since the 1990s. However, a risk remains even in the natural floodplain during rare floods. In Bavaria, the Flood Information Service (HND) is responsible for flood warnings and flood forecasts as well as information on current water levels on rivers and lakes.
